London Marylebone Station is equipped with a range of facilities designed to ensure a convenient and accessible experience for all travelers. There is a well-staffed ticket office, open from early morning to late at night, along with ticket machines accessible to those with disabilities. You can rest easy knowing that step-free access is available throughout the station, making it accessible for everyone. Additionally, induction loops are in place for those with hearing impairments.
Although there aren’t waiting rooms, the station does provide seating areas. You will also find public toilets, accessible toilets, and baby changing facilities within the station, which are essential for any long-distance journey. If you're looking for a place to grab a bite or a coffee, there are various food outlets and coffee shops. The station even hosts a small selection of shops, including a newsagent, a flower stall, and a shoe repairer among others. Wi-Fi connectivity is readily available, ensuring you remain connected while on the move.
At London Marylebone Station, you have access to a multitude of onward travel options. The taxi rank right outside the station provides easy connections, with buses also readily available nearby. Those heading into the heart of London can make use of the Marylebone Underground station, which is on the Bakerloo Line. A short walk will take you to Baker Street station, where you can board Circle, Hammersmith and City, Jubilee, and Metropolitan Line services.
For those keen on cycling, you'll be pleased to find a Santander Cycles docking station located conveniently at Boston Place, right at the side of Marylebone Station. A good amount of secure bicycle storage is also offered for season ticket holders, perfect for those integrating cycling into their daily commute.

Caersws train station may not boast a vast array of amenities, but it excels in providing essential services. Though there is no ticket office on-site, a ticket machine is available for purchasing and collecting your train tickets. It's important to note that this machine is accessible and card-only, perfect for those who rely on digital transactions. If you need further assistance or information, contacting Transport for Wales is recommended, as the station does not have staffed help points or waiting rooms. Facilities like toilets, refreshment outlets, and stores are currently unavailable, so plan accordingly.
While the station provides partial step-free access, it's vital to approach with awareness as some parts are not wholly accessible. The station falls under Category B1, featuring a moderately steep ramp from the B4569. With 20 parking spaces available and free of charge, parking is convenient, though there are no designated accessible spaces. Biking enthusiasts will appreciate the sheltered stand for bicycles, albeit unsupervised by CCTV.
For those traveling further afield, Caersws station provides effective transport links. Rail replacement services and local buses are readily accessible near The Unicorn Pub and Hotel on Bridge Street, offering further travel into the rural heart of Wales or onward journeys. While the station itself does not provide bicycle hire, bike transport remains an option for exploring the surrounding area. Keep an eye out for local taxis and nearby car hire services for additional connectivity to your desired locations.
